Disused quarry above Mutton Cove
Disused quarry above Mutton Cove
The wall of large stone blocks is the seaward wall of a disused quarry near the top of the cliff above Mutton Cove. Above the Portland Freestone quarried at the site are the basal Purbeck strata (thin beds of limestone). A party of young rock climbers are at the base of the vertical cliff below the old quarry wall.
